Gravesend Author: J. L. Abramo Published: September 25, 2012 by Down and Out Books Category: Mystery, Crime, Brooklyn, Police Main Character: Detective Lieutenant James Samson, Detective Sergeant Lou Vota, Detective Thomas Murphy, Lorraine DiMarco, Detective Sandra Rosen, Detective Marina Ivanov, Joe Campo, Tony Territo On an afternoon in early February, the neighborhood is stunned and horrified when the lifeless body of an eight-year-old boy is discovered abandoned on the roof of an apartment building. The body has been mysteriously mutilated. No clues, no witnesses, no apparent reason. When a second boy is found two days later in the same condition, Homicide Detectives Samson, Vota and Murphy of Brooklyn’s 61st Precinct fear that the two boys were victims of the same killer. |

Counting to Infinity Author: J. L. Abramo Published: November 7, 2011 by Down and Out Books Series Name: Jake Diamond Mysteries Category: Private Eye Main Character: Jake Diamond, Darlene Roman, Ray Boyle, Joey Russo, Vinnie Strings, Ralph Battle San Francisco private investigator Jake Diamond is known for his stained neckties and stash of sour-mash whiskey; but Jake is more likely to be toting a worn paperback Classic novel than a handgun. More over-easy than hard-boiled, Diamond can be beaten up and knocked around without taking it too personally; but when his friends and loved ones are threatened, it’s a different story. Clutching at Straws Author: J. L. Abramo Published: September 19, 2011 by Down and Out Books Series Name: Jake Diamond Mysteries Category: Private Eye Main Character: Jake Diamond, Darlene Roman, Joey Russo, Vinnie Strings Lefty Wright had it all figured. In fact he was doing the math as he crawled into the deserted house through the kitchen window. Get to the bedroom, crack open the wall safe, grab the envelope, fifteen minutes. One thousand dollars a minute. Nice score. What Lefty neglected to factor in were the unknowns. And when the police nab him red-handed and discover the dead body of a prominent Criminal Courts Judge stuffed beneath the bed, Lefty finds himself charged with first degree murder with no shoes, no one believing in his innocence, and one phone call.
